Transaction 5e243132749c399045285002021db30fc2f4820d15a7d1de15894313fdc5fbb6
1 Input
1 Output
-
5e243132749c399045285002021db30fc2f4820d15a7d1de15894313fdc5fbb6:0
- value
- 39999756
- script pubkey
- OP_0 OP_PUSHBYTES_20 11d404c3c14d468575db59d125da6f4f04ae2840
- address
- bc1qz82qfs7pf4rg2awmt8gjtkn0fuz2u2zqcqhxuh